Why are Ukraine’s minerals essential to keeping United States military help streaming?

Share

Ukraine has actually used to strike a handle U.S. President Donald Trump for ongoing American military help in exchange for establishing Ukraine’s mineral market, which might offer an important source of the unusual earth aspects that are vital for lots of type of innovation.

Trump stated he desired such an offer previously this month, and it was at first proposed last fall by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y as part of his strategy to enhance Kyiv’s hand in future settlements with Moscow.

” We truly have this huge capacity in the area which we manage,” Andrii Yermak, chief of personnel to the Ukrainian president, stated in a special interview with The Associated Press. “We are interested to work, to establish, with our partners, to start with, with the United States.”

Here is a take a look at Ukraine’s unusual earth market and how an offer may come together:

What are unusual earth aspects?

Uncommon earth aspects are a set of 17 aspects that are vital in lots of type of customer innovation, consisting of cellular phones, hard disks and electrical and hybrid lorries.

It is uncertain if Trump is looking for particular aspects in Ukraine, which likewise has other minerals to provide.

” It can be lithium. It can be titanium, uranium, lots of others,” Yerkmak stated. “It’s a lot.”

China, Trump’s primary geopolitical foe, is the world’s biggest manufacturer of unusual earth aspects. Both the U.S and Europe have actually looked for to lower their reliance on Beijing.

For Ukraine, such an offer would make sure that its most significant and most substantial ally does not freeze military assistance, which would be ravaging for the nation that will quickly enter its 4th year of war versus Russia’s full-blown intrusion.

The concept likewise comes at a time when trustworthy and undisturbed access to crucial minerals is significantly difficult to come by worldwide.

What is the state of the Ukrainian minerals market?

Ukraine’s unusual earth aspects are mainly untapped since of the war and since of state policies managing the mineral market. The nation likewise does not have excellent details to assist the advancement of unusual earth mining.

Geological information is thin since mineral reserves are spread throughout Ukraine, and existing research studies are thought about mainly insufficient. The market’s real capacity is clouded by inadequate research study, according to business people and experts.

In basic, the outlook for Ukrainian natural deposits is appealing. The nation’s reserves of titanium, a crucial element for the aerospace, medical and automobile markets, are thought to be amongst Europe’s biggest. Ukraine likewise holds a few of Europe’s biggest recognized reserves of lithium, which is needed to produce batteries, ceramics and glass.

In 2021, the Ukrainian mineral market represented 6.1% of the nation’s gdp and 30% of exports.

An approximated 40% of Ukraine’s metal mineral resources are unattainable since of Russian profession, according to information from We Develop Ukraine, a Kyiv-based think tank. Ukraine has actually argued that it remains in Trump’s interest to establish the rest before Russian advances record more.

The European Commission determined Ukraine as a possible provider for over 20 crucial basic materials and concluded that the nation’s accession to the EU might enhance the European economy.

What takes place next?

Information of any offer will likely establish in conferences in between U.S. and Ukrainian authorities. Zelenskyy and Trump will most likely talk about the topic when they satisfy.

U.S. business have actually revealed interest, according to Ukrainian organization authorities. However striking an official offer would likely need legislation, geological studies and settlement of particular terms.

It is uncertain what sort of security assurances business would need to run the risk of operating in Ukraine, even in case of a ceasefire. And nobody understands for sure what sort of funding contracts would underpin agreements in between Ukraine and U.S business.
